Overview

Government Contract Bid Protests is an authoritative, insiders perspective on best practices for effectively pursuing and defending government contract bid protests. Featuring partners from some of the nations leading law firms, these experts guide the reader through the various components of the bid protest process. These top lawyers reveal there advice on identifying key players and their roles, understanding the different venues used for protests and the benefits of each, navigating the negotiation process, and developing the critical legal skills needed for assisting clients in filing a bid protest. From asking the right questions during a debriefing to identifying common trouble spots, these authors explain important factors for clients and attorneys to keep in mind when preparing for a protest. Additionally, these leaders discuss recent trends in government contract bid protests and anticipate what might be in store for the future. The different niches represented and the breadth of perspectives presented enable readers to get inside some of the great legal minds of today, as these experienced lawyers offer up their thoughts around the keys to navigating this ever-evolving area of law.
